Battery
Dead coin batteries are a common reason for a key fob not to unlock or lock the car. There are signs that the battery is about to get worn out, such as the range of the key fob reducing over time. If you've tried everything else including reprogramming your key or using an additional fob, it's most likely that the battery in your coin-cell isn't working properly.
The procedure for changing the battery is quite easy. The transmitter housing section can be opened with an screwdriver. Remove the cover. Take off the battery that was in place and replace it with a new one, making sure that the polarity is correct (i.e. the "+" symbol must be facing downwards. Close the housing section of the transmitter, and then insert it into the front of the key fob. Both parts should click together.
After replacing the battery, ensure to sync it with the vehicle by pressing any button on the remote for about 15 minutes. This will ensure that the vehicle can recognize the key as a legitimate replacement and activates the keyless entry system correctly. If you haven't done this before, the key might not respond to commands from the remote and will require the reprogramming. The owner's manual explains the process of reprogramming.
Transponder
The key fob contains an embedded microchip that communicates with the car to unlock doors or to start the motor. The chip is equipped with a digital identity that prevents the car from starting without the correct key. The digital identity makes cloning or copying a transponder more difficult and lowers the chance that your car is left unattended. However, it is not foolproof, and criminals are able to be able to gain access using various methods.
If the key does not work It could be that the key fob is out of battery or another component. In this case it is best to try to determine what's going on. One way to find out is to test the battery's voltage using a multimeter. If the battery is working and is functioning, then there must be something else causing the keyfob's to not work.
If you're replacing your battery, make sure it's the right size. The battery should fit into the tiny slot in the housing made of plastic. It should be a 3 Volt battery, CR2032. These batteries are standard and can be purchased through the internet or in most auto stores. If you are unable to locate the right replacement battery it's recommended to go to a locksmith and ask for help. They'll be able provide you with the right battery for your key fob.

Key
skoda smart key Fabia is equipped with a remote keyless system that permits users to lock and unlock their car by pressing a button. The key comes with an electronic transponder chip which disables the car's immobiliser. When the key is inserted into the ignition, it sends an audio signal to the receiver module, causing the engine of the car to start. You can use an OBD diagnostic tool to diagnose the remote keyless system if it is not functioning. Be sure to ensure that the battery that is 12 volts is fully charged, and that all electrical connectors are in good condition prior to using the OBD tool.
The most common reason for the Fabia remote not working is because the coin battery in the key fob has died. The key fob may display signs of a faulty power source, such as intermittent operation or a shorter range. It is important to replace the battery with one of the exact type size, voltage, and color as the original.
If the key fob has been exposed to clean tap water or rain, it can be cleaned using paper towels and isopropyl alcohol. However, if the key fob was submerged into soapy water or dropped on the floor and not dried out properly, it could have an internal electronic chip damaged that is not repairable.
